Transaction 310505eb12f1f73e5cbef7dedaa5b6e73a547b9e7d1fba752f9b3751d9b02bae
1 Input
1 Outputs
- 310505eb12f1f73e5cbef7dedaa5b6e73a547b9e7d1fba752f9b3751d9b02bae:0
value 10037966
address 1FK8bgNP8oyoTq1ZpnMfEc9X16vcgzHC51